The first name Pierre has its origins in the Latin name "Petrus," which means "rock" or "stone," symbolizing strength and stability. This name first appeared in ancient Rome and has been widely used in French-speaking regions, where it became popular due to its association with Saint Peter, one of the apostles of Jesus and a foundational figure in Christianity. The name Pierre embodies qualities of reliability and steadfastness, reflecting the characteristics of those who initially bore it, often seen as leaders or figures of authority. Variations of the name can be found across different cultures, including Peter in English, Pietro in Italian, and Pedro in Spanish, each maintaining the core meaning while adapting to local linguistic nuances. The name has remained popular throughout history, often associated with notable figures in various fields, including literature, politics, and the arts.
